Abstract

A method for prioritizing processing of interactions at a contact center, the method including: identifying an interaction to be prioritized for processing; identifying a person associated with the interaction; identifying an influence level of the person associated with the interaction; and prioritizing the interaction for processing based on the influence level of the person associated with the interaction.

Claims (40)

1. A method for prioritizing processing of interactions at a contact center, the method comprising:

identifying an interaction to be prioritized for processing;

identifying a person associated with the interaction;

identifying an influence level of the person associated with the interaction; and

prioritizing the interaction for processing based on the influence level of the person associated with the interaction,

wherein the prioritizing comprises ignoring the interaction when the influence level is below a preset threshold, and

wherein the prioritizing further comprises distributing the interaction to a first agent of a plurality of contact center agents when the influence level is equal to or higher than a second threshold, and to a second agent of the plurality of contact center agents when the influence level is below the second threshold.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the interaction is a message posted on a social media channel.

3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the person associated with the interaction is an author of the message.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the influence level is based on a size of the person's online social media network.

5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the size of the person's online social media network is based on a number of people directly or indirectly connected to the person via the online social media network.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the prioritizing is further based on one or more of actionability of the interaction, sentiment of the interaction, or the business value of the person associated with the interaction.
